The Future of Multi-Data Center Synchronization evolves, we can expect advancements in how WhatsApp handles multi-data center synchronizationHybrid Replication Strategies A combination of synchronous and asynchronous replication could be employed based on data type or urgency, optimizing speed and consistency.Real-time Conflict Resolution Advanced algorithms could predict and resolve potential conflicts arising from lag even before they occur.Enhanced Data Encryption Data encryption in transit and at rest across all data centers can further strengthen data security and privacy.By embracing these advancements and prioritizing user experience, WhatsApp can ensure a seamless and secure communication experience regardless of the physical location of its data centers.Important Caveat The Lack of Official ConfirmationIt's crucial to remember that the information presented here regarding synchronization methods and data center architecture is based on educated speculation and technical possibilities. WhatsApp hasn't officially disclosed the specifics of its multi-data center strategy or the exact techniques they employ.
Safeguarding the Chats How WhatsApp Prevents Database Corruption Dur Syria Email List ing Software UpgradesWhatsApp, a global communication powerhouse, constantly evolves with new features and functionality. However, these software upgrades can pose a risk database corruption. This article explores the measures WhatsApp likely takes to prevent database corruption during software upgrades, ensuring the security and integrity of your messages.The Delicate Dance Upgrading Software While Protecting DataSoftware upgrades are essential for introducing new features, fixing bugs, and enhancing security. However, if not handled meticulously, they can corrupt the underlying database, leading to data loss or inconsistencies. Here's why preventing database corruption is crucial for WhatsAppData Loss Corrupted data can render messages, media files, and contact information inaccessible, causing significant inconvenience and frustration for users.Loss of User Trust Database corruption can erode user trust in WhatsApp's ability to safeguard their data.Disruption of Service In severe cases, database corruption could lead to service disruptions, impacting millions of users worldwide.

A Multi-Layered Defense Safeguarding the DatabaseTo minimize the risk of corruption during upgrades, WhatsApp likely employs a multi-layered defense strategyRigorous Testing Prior to deployment, new software versions undergo extensive testing in isolated environments. This testing simulates upgrade scenarios and helps identify potential issues that could lead to corruption.Database Backups WhatsApp likely creates regular, comprehensive backups of the database. These backups serve as a safety net in case of unforeseen issues during upgrades. In the worst-case scenario, WhatsApp can restore the database from a backup, minimizing data loss.Transactional Upgrades The upgrade process itself might be implemented using database transactions. As discussed previously, transactions ensure that all database changes associated with the upgrade are treated as a single unit. If any errors occur during the upgrade, the entire transaction can be rolled back, preventing the database from being corrupted.Rollback Plans A well-defined rollback plan is crucial.